Box Score INDIANAPOLIS – The IUPUI men's tennis team fell to cross-town rival Butler on Wednesday afternoon, 4-3. Three Jags earned singles points in the hard-fought match.
The Bulldogs took the early lead with the doubles point.
Will Thurin and
Noah Viste kept the point in reaching distance with a number three doubles win, 6-3. It wasn't enough as IUPUI lost in both the one and two doubles matches.
Kamil Kozerski and
Emil Jankowski fell in the number one spot, 6-3 while
Steven Paz and
Luka Rodic dropped the number two match, 6-4.
Singles play was hard fought from top to bottom with three of the six matches going into three sets. IUPUI recorded three wins but couldn't collect one more point to earn the win over the Bulldogs.
Kozerski earned a big win in the number one spot, 6-1, 1-6, 6-4 while Paz earned the number two singles point, 7-5, 6-2. Rodic collected the third point for the Jags in the number four singles spot, 6-2, 4-6, 7-5.
Butler took the number three, five and six singles matches to earn the win, 4-3. Viste fell in the number three spot in three sets, 3-6, 6-2, 7-6.
Nate Day dropped the number five match, 6-1, 6-0 while
Eli Mercer lost in the number six spot, 6-2, 7-5.
